TravelComments.com – Kgalagadi Transfrontier Park: Renovations taking place at Kamqua Picnic Site!

 

(Posted 09th July 2024)

 

The management of Kgalagadi Transfrontier Park has announced that much needed renovations will take place at Kamqua Picnic Site from yesterday, 08 July 2024, until… READ MORE
